Mission

TO IMPROVE THE CAPACITY OF SCHOLARS TO STUDY INSTITUTIONAL PROBLEMS IN THEIR OWN COUNTRIES THROUGH WORKSHOPS AND OTHER EDUCATIONAL ACTIVITIES & TO CONDUCT AND PROMOTE RESEARCH ON THE INSTITUTIONS OF REAL ECONOMIC SYSTEMS.
